What Is Nu Calgon Ice Machine Cleaner and Why Use It?

Nu Calgon Ice Machine Cleaner is a professional-grade, food-grade acid solution expertly formulated by Nu-Calgon to effectively remove troublesome lime scale and mineral deposits, ensuring your ice machine runs efficiently and produces clean, fresh-tasting ice. This potent liquid cleaner, available in a convenient 16 fluid ounces bottle, utilizes a blend of phosphoric acid and citric acid to safely descale and clean the intricate components of ice machines, particularly those with nickel-plated evaporators. It’s recognized as an OEM Part for many systems, indicating its high compatibility and reliability across a wide range of units, and it has only a mild chemical odor that dissipates after rinsing.

You should use Nu Calgon Ice Machine Cleaner because consistent cleaning is crucial for maintaining both the performance and hygiene of your ice maker, preventing costly breakdowns and ensuring your ice is always crystal clear and free of impurities. Its specialized formulation is not only effective for routine maintenance in both commercial and residential settings—including models like GE Monogram ice maker units and even reportedly Uline ice makers—but it’s also designed for use in all makes and models of icemakers, encompassing various types such as cubers, flakers, drum, and tube ice machines. Regular application, following the usage rate instructions (typically 16 fluid ounces with three gallons of system water), prolongs the lifespan of your machine and helps maintain its impressive 4.7 out of 5 stars customer rating by preventing mineral buildup.

How Often Should I Clean My Ice Machine with Nu Calgon Cleaner?

For optimal performance and hygiene, you should clean your ice machine with Nu Calgon Ice Machine Cleaner generally every 3 to 6 months. This frequency is a widely recommended guideline for both commercial and residential units, crucial for preventing the buildup of stubborn lime scale and mineral deposits that can impact ice quality and machine efficiency. Factors like your water hardness, how often you use the machine, and the specific manufacturer’s instructions can influence whether you lean towards a more frequent cleaning schedule (e.g., every three months) or can extend it closer to six months. Regular cleaning with Nu Calgon Ice Machine Cleaner helps ensure your machine produces crystal clear, fresh-tasting ice and prolongs its lifespan.

What Precautions Should I Take When Using Nu Calgon Cleaner?

When using Nu Calgon Ice Machine Cleaner, prioritizing your safety is paramount. Always begin by consulting your ice machine’s operating manual and the cleaner’s Safety Data Sheet (SDS) for specific guidelines, which are your primary resources for safe handling. Crucially, always wear app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E), including protective gloves and eye protection, to safeguard against accidental splashes or contact. Ensure you work in a well-ventilated area to prevent inhaling fumes and guarantee the cleaner only touches acid-safe surfaces within your machine. Remember, never mix Nu Calgon Ice Machine Cleaner with ammonia, bleach, or other cleaning chemicals, as this can create dangerous and harmful reactions. Following these vital steps will help ensure a safe and effective cleaning process for your machine.

Understanding Nugget Ice Makers: Relevance to Ice Machine Cleaning

Nugget ice makers, renowned for producing soft, chewable ice using a specialized auger system, present unique cleaning considerations compared to other ice machine types. This is because, unlike cuber machines that freeze purified water, nugget ice makers utilize the entire water source to create their distinctive small, compressed pellets. This production method means nugget ice machines accumulate significantly more mineral deposits and lime scale, requiring more frequent and thorough cleaning to maintain hygiene and performance. While the general cleaning process shares similarities with other ice makers, the increased mineral buildup in the intricate auger mechanisms necessitates consistent attention with powerful, nickel-safe solutions like Nu Calgon Ice Machine Cleaner, or specialized cleaners designed specifically for these models, even when self-cleaning features are present. Regular maintenance is crucial to ensure consistent hygiene and optimal performance.
